About
8VC is a venture capital firm founded in 2015 by Joe Lonsdale, Drew Oetting, Alex Kolicich, and Jake Medwell 12. The firm was originally headquartered in San Francisco; in November 2020, Lonsdale relocated the headquarters to Austin, Texas, where the firm now maintains its primary office alongside additional offices in San Francisco and New York 23.
Joe Lonsdale, the firm’s Managing Partner, co-founded Palantir Technologies, Addepar, and OpenGov prior to establishing 8VC 3. The firm and its predecessor funds manage total committed capital exceeding $6 billion 4. In March 2023, 8VC announced Fund V with $880 million in new capital, bringing total committed capital past the $6 billion mark 4. In January 2025, the firm began raising Fund VI, securing $998 million in limited partner capital with a focus on supply chain, logistics, and government technology 56.
As of March 2026, 8VC has invested in 360 companies over 11 years, with an average of 30 new investments annually over the past decade 7. The firm’s portfolio has produced 35 unicorns, 16 IPOs, and 39 acquisitions 7.
8VC operates a distinctive “Build” program that dedicates 25-30% of capital to co-founding startups, assembling teams to tackle problems in healthcare, defense, logistics, finance, and biosciences 48. Notable companies created through this program include National Resilience (co-founded by Drew Oetting) 1.
Stated Thesis
8VC’s publicly stated mission is: “The world is broken. Let’s fix it” 4. The firm frames entrepreneurship as addressing systemic dysfunction in critical industries, drawing on historical parallels to American frontier innovation 4.
The firm publicly focuses on six core areas 4: 1. AI applications and services 2. Genomic engineering and life sciences 3. Advanced manufacturing 4. Healthcare innovation 5. Defense and security 6. Logistics and finance
Jake Medwell has described the firm’s approach: “We don’t just invest and take a backseat. We work with our portfolio companies and spend meaningful time integrating them with the best partners and people for success on all sides” 5.
8VC emphasizes its network of industry partners, including Prologis, Ryder, NFI, Penske, Lineage, and Daimler in the logistics sector 5. The firm also retains industry advisers such as Chris Sultemeier (former Walmart Transportation President/CEO) and Alan Gershenhorn (former UPS EVP) 5.
Inferred Thesis
Based on 8VC’s verified portfolio and public data:
Stage distribution: Primarily seed and Series A. Tracxn data shows 108 investments at seed stage (average round size $7.95M), 127 at Series A ($22.8M average), and 44 at Series B ($73.1M average) 7. The firm’s model skews toward earlier stages, consistent with the Build program’s company-creation approach.
Sector focus: 8VC has a distinctive “hard tech” and government/defense orientation relative to other venture firms. Key sectors include defense technology (Anduril), logistics and supply chain (Flexport, project44, Deliverr), healthcare and life sciences (Guardant Health, Oscar, Orca Bio), enterprise software, fintech, and transportation (Joby Aviation, The Boring Company) 357.
Geographic concentration: Headquartered in Austin, TX, with significant Bay Area and East Coast portfolio presence. The Austin move in 2020 signaled an investment orientation toward companies building outside traditional Silicon Valley 2.
Build program as differentiator: The co-founding model (25-30% of capital) means 8VC is often the earliest investor with deep operational involvement from day one 48. This is atypical for a multi-billion-dollar venture firm.
Political and policy dimension: Lonsdale co-founded the Cicero Institute, a nonpartisan policy organization that has passed 175 bills across nearly 30 states 3. The firm’s “American Dynamism”-style investments in defense, government software, and infrastructure have an ideological component beyond pure financial returns.
Co-investor patterns: Frequently co-invests with Founders Fund, Andreessen Horowitz (American Dynamism), and defense-focused investors.
Notable exits: Oculus (acquired by Facebook), Deliverr (acquired by Shopify for $2.1B), OpenGov (sold for $1.8B), RelateIQ, Baton (acquired by Ryder) 35.
